.buying_guide_wrapper{color:#000;position:fixed;width:100%;height:100%;top:0;left:0;z-index:99999;display:none}.buying_guide_wrapper.active{display:block}.overlay{position:absolute;left:0;top:0;width:100%;height:100%;background-color:#000;opacity:.4}.buying_guide{position:absolute;background:#fff;top:50%;left:50%;width:1040px;max-width:calc(100% - 30px);max-height:calc(100% - 30px);transform:translate(-50%,-50%);border-radius:8px;overflow:auto}.buying_guide_sides{display:flex}.side_buying_guide.left{flex:0 0 298px;min-width:298px;padding:55px 22px;background-image:url(../../../../../../../themes/drblend/img/buying-guide-background.webp);background-position:center;color:#fff;position:relative;z-index:1}.side_buying_guide.left>*{z-index:2;position:relative}.side_buying_guide.left:before{content:'';position:absolute;left:0;top:0;width:100%;height:100%;background-color:#000;opacity:.8}.side_buying_guide.right{flex-grow:1}.left_title_bg{font-size:40px;line-height:47px;font-weight:700;margin-bottom:9px}.description_bg{font-size:14px;line-height:16.4px}.progress_bg{font-size:16px;line-height:19px;color:var(--green);margin-bottom:2px}.question_bg{color:#000;font-size:32px;font-weight:700;line-height:38px;padding-right:150px}.side_buying_guide.right{padding:38px 37px 20px;position:relative}ul.answers_bg{padding:0;margin:0;list-style:none;display:flex;gap:15px;margin-bottom:25px}ul.navigation_bg{padding:0;margin:0;list-style:none;display:flex;justify-content:flex-end;gap:32px}.navigation_button_bg{cursor:pointer}.header_bg{position:relative;margin-bottom:28px}.close_bg{font-size:12px;line-height:14px;cursor:pointer;background-color:#FAFAFA;color:#000;text-decoration:underline;border-radius:48px;display:inline-block;padding:12px 27px;position:absolute;top:38px;right:37px;z-index:1}button.answer_button{background-color:#fff;border:1px solid #000;padding:8px 32px;border-radius:40px;display:block;width:100%;margin-top:auto}.answer_bg{padding:15px;text-align:center;position:relative;cursor:pointer;flex:0 1 190px;max-width:calc(33.3333% - (30px / 3));display:flex;flex-direction:column;border:1px solid #F4F9F6;border-radius:16px}.answer_bg.active{color:var(--green)}.answer_bg.active:before{content:'';position:absolute;left:0;top:0;width:100%;height:100%;background-color:var(--green);opacity:.06;border-radius:16px}.answer_bg.active:after{content:'';position:absolute;right:-8px;top:-8px;background-image:url(../../../../../../../themes/drblend/img/checkmark-bg.svg);width:32px;height:32px}.answer_wording{font-size:20px;line-height:24px;font-weight:700;margin-bottom:5px}.answer_explanation{opacity:.4;font-size:12px;line-height:14px;margin-bottom:10px}.button_text{display:none}.answer_bg:not(.active) .button_text.unselected{display:inline}.answer_bg.active .answer_button{background-color:var(--green);border-color:var(--green);color:#fff}.answer_bg.active .button_text.selected{display:inline}.background-image{margin-bottom:14px}.image_answer img{height:95px;width:100%}.navigation_button_bg{background-repeat:no-repeat}.navigation_button_bg.next{background-image:url(../../../../../../../themes/drblend/img/arrow-next.svg);background-position:right center;padding-right:16px}.navigation_button_bg.back{background-image:url(../../../../../../../themes/drblend/img/arrow-prev.svg);background-position:left center;padding-left:16px}ul.steps_bg{padding:0;margin:0;list-style:none;position:relative;display:block}li.step_bg{display:none}li.step_bg.active{display:block}.recommended_product_image img{max-width:100%;height:auto}.recommended_product{display:flex;gap:20px;align-items:center}.recommendation_side.right{flex:0 1 300px;max-width:50%}.recommendation_side.left{flex:1}.title_recommendation{font-size:32px;line-height:1.1875;font-weight:700}.subtitle_recommendation{font-size:16px;line-height:1.25;margin-bottom:13px}.atc_button{border:none;display:block;width:100%;background-color:var(--green);color:#fff;border-radius:40px;font-size:16px;line-height:19px;padding:14px 32px 14px 32px;text-align:center;transition:background-color 0.3s}.atc_button:hover{background-color:var(--hover-green)}.atc_button.loading:after{content:'';display:inline-block;width:13px;height:13px;border:2px solid #fff;border-radius:50%;border-top-color:transparent;animation:spin 1s linear infinite;margin-left:6px;position:relative;top:2px}ul.product_usps{padding:0;margin:0;list-style:none;padding-left:15px;margin-bottom:25px}.product_usps li{font-size:12px;line-height:20px;background-image:url(../../../../../../../themes/drblend/img/checkmark-usp.svg);background-repeat:no-repeat;background-position:0 4px;padding-left:20px;margin-bottom:5px;opacity:.35;color:var(--font-color)}.product_usps li:last-child{margin-bottom:0}.more_info_wrapper{margin-top:11px;text-align:center}a.more_info_link{font-size:12px;line-height:14px;color:var(--green)}a.more_info_link:hover{text-decoration:underline}@keyframes spin{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}.answer_right{flex:1;display:flex;flex-direction:column}@media (max-width:991px){.side_buying_guide.left{display:none}}@media (max-width:767px){ul.answers_bg{flex-direction:column;gap:12px}.answer_bg{flex:1;max-width:100%}.question_bg{padding-right:0}button.answer_button{display:none}.answer_bg{flex-direction:row;gap:20px;align-items:center}.header_bg{margin-bottom:23px}div#wpadminbar{display:none!important}.close_bg{background:transparent;padding:0}.side_buying_guide.right{padding:28px 22px}.close_bg{top:28px;right:22px}.answer_right{text-align:left}.image_answer{flex:0 0 84px;max-width:84px}.image_answer img{height:auto;max-height:67px;width:auto;max-width:100%}.recommended_product{flex-direction:column;gap:22px}.recommendation_side.right{flex:0 0 278px;max-width:278px}.result .progress_bg{margin-bottom:10px}}